A test strategy is a high-level document detailing the approach and general testing objectives for a software testing process, guiding the design and execution of tests to ensure product quality and alignment with business goals. It serves as a blueprint for achieving testing efficacy within resource constraints, addressing critical aspects such as scope, resources, schedule, and risk management.